Cheri Williams spent much of her career inside child welfare believing she was helping save children.

Then she began questioning the story the system was telling — and her own role inside it.

In this conversation, Cheri talks about the moment that forced her to reconsider more than twenty years of work, why institutions can become attached to narratives that preserve their own power, and what happens when the people living a story are not the people authorized to define it.

We explore saviorism, lived experience, power, fear, compliance, imagination, and why systems can become so invested in the stories they already believe that alternative futures become difficult to imagine.

Cheri also offers a powerful definition of Narrative Intelligence: “careful stewardship” of the stories we tell ourselves, believe, and tell about other people.

And she ends somewhere important:

“I’m filled with hope.”

Because when people begin telling new stories, they find one another. Community forms. And what once seemed impossible can begin to become real.
